Description
Allegro Acoustics is an consultancy and fit-out company specialising in acoustics, noise control, and AV.
Map Location
-
C1 South City Business Park Tallaght D24 PN28 Co. Dublin
Allegro Acoustics is an consultancy and fit-out company specialising in acoustics, noise control, and AV.
C1 South City Business Park Tallaght D24 PN28 Co. Dublin
Add a review